India presses for legal framework to guide adoption of digital public infrastructure

India’s government emissary (Sherpa) to the G20 Amitabh Kant has underscored the need for a clearer definition of digital public infrastructure (DPI) and a legal framework to guide its deployment.
According to Kant, there is a vacuum where the governance framework for adoption of DPI should be, and a legal framework is needed as India is using its presidency of the G20 to lobby for more DPI access, reports the Economic Times of India (ET).
